About Duke University Hospital
Pursue your passion for caring with Duke University Hospital in Durham, North Carolina, which is consistently ranked among the best in the United States and is the number one hospital in North Carolina, according to U.S. News and World Report for 2023-2024. Duke University Hospital is the largest of Duke Health's three hospitals and features 1048 patient beds, 65 operating rooms, as well as comprehensive diagnostic and therapeutic facilities, including a regional emergency/trauma center, an endo-surgery center, and more.
Seeking a positive and effective leader with exceptional leadership, as well technical expertise, and collaborative qualities across disciplines (nursing, medical imaging professionals, radiologists) to continually improve the infrastructure of Interventional Radiology. The successful candidate must demonstrate excellent communication, critical thinking skills, and problem solving, while promoting the highest quality patient care. This person should be one who strives for excellence and leads by example of the Duke Health Values.
The Radiology Supervisor for Interventional Radiology must be a strong advocate for patients and the team they lead. They need to be technologically savvy, able to troubleshoot and solve the most difficult challenges, promote a supportive and positive work culture and foster continuous process improvement efforts.
This is a leadership position, rotating 8-hours per day, 40 hours per week; to include possibility of call, weekends, holidays, and inclement weather. This role includes management of the Interventional Radiology areas of CT, Neuro, Vascular, Ultrasound, and Scheduling.
Team leader experience and active ARRT, ARDMS, and/or CNMT credentials required; procedural experience preferred.
Work requires required registry/certification in applicable imaging modality - American Registry of Radiologic Technologist (ARRT) registry or American Registry of Diagnostic Medical Sonographers (ARDMS) or Nuclear Medicine Technologist Certification Board (NMTCB).
Four years of experience in an imaging modality (Radiologic Tech, MR, CT, Mammography, Nuclear Medicine, Sonography, Interventional Radiology) is required. Two years of team leader or applicable supervisory experience is preferred.
Certification as prescribed by ARRT, ARDMS/CCI, and/or NMTCB.
